How was the calendar compiled?

The Imperial Palace Calendar serves as a popular means for introducing palace collections and promoting traditional Chinese culture, with elaborate content, text and images on every page. It delivers the essence of China through the Palace Museum's abundant relics and profound cultural reach.

Experts and specialists curate its content, imbuing the calendar with a deeper understanding of artwork and history. The 2019 calendar has benefited from contributions by experts Feng Hejun, Liu Yun and Han Jing from the Palace Museum Department of Objects as well as Li Shi, an expert in the Calligraphy Department.

Shan Jixiang, director of the Palace Museum, said that as a special publication of the Imperial Palace, The Imperial Palace Calendar has become its own brand and won over many people. The calendar appears to a bridge a gap between audiences and the collections by popularizing and spreading the culture of the Imperial Palace.

Shan also said readers can appreciate different pictures of relics and record daily life while using the calendar, which are practical functions.
